The Unitrol thermostat is built to the most ex-
acting standards and is a precision instrument
which should never need re-calibration. However
through tampering, misuse or other reasons, if
the thermostat is found to be more than 10º from
normal, a re-calibration may be performed by a
qualified service technician. The following are the
steps for this procedure:
1. Turn the thermostat to OFF to allow the unit to
cool down.
2. When the water temperature is room temper-
ature, turn the thermostat dial until the main
burner ignites.
3. Slowly, turn the thermostat dial counterclock-
wise until the flame on the burner goes out.
4. Place a thermometer into the water jacket to
determine the temperature of the water.
5. Pull off the thermostat dial and lift off the out-
side cover.

6. Turn the temperature stop to correspond to
the actual water temperature. Mark the loca-
tion of the stop for reference.
7. Turn the stop slowly until the control snaps
off. Holding the stop to prevent rotation,
carefully loosen the stop adjustment nut (see
illustration above).
